well-intentioned effort
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"well-intentioned effort"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to describe an attempt or action that is made with good intentions, even if the outcome may not be successful. Example: "Although the project did not achieve its goals, it was a well-intentioned effort to improve community engagement."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
Ensure clarity by specifying who had the good intentions. For example, "The government's well-intentioned effort" is more specific than just "a well-intentioned effort."
Common error
Avoid using "well-intentioned effort" as a shield to deflect criticism of actions that have significant negative consequences. Acknowledge the harm caused, even if the intent was good.

FAQs
How can I use "well-intentioned effort" in a sentence?
You can use "well-intentioned effort" to describe an attempt that was made with good intentions, even if it didn't succeed. For example, "Although the new policy failed, it was a "well-intentioned effort" to improve employee morale."
What's a good alternative to "well-intentioned effort"?
Alternatives include "good-faith attempt", "noble endeavor", or "earnest attempt", depending on the specific nuance you want to convey.
Is it always appropriate to describe something as a "well-intentioned effort"?
While it acknowledges good intentions, using "well-intentioned effort" might not be suitable if the negative outcomes are severe or if there was a lack of due diligence. In such cases, it may appear dismissive of the harm caused.
What is the difference between "well-intentioned effort" and "successful initiative"?
"Well-intentioned effort" focuses on the positive intentions behind an action, regardless of the result. "Successful initiative", on the other hand, emphasizes the positive outcome of an action, regardless of the initial intentions.
